Am Donnerstag, 15. März 2007 19:47 schrieb Vladimir Kuznetsov:
> First step to 3d can be "read-only" simulation that user can view (and
> can modify only fixed amount of numerical parameters) but can not
> create using GUI. It still not requires implementing 3d editor, but
> already can show lots of cool things (for example 3d molecules, this
> is what I mentioned in previous post). Then we could implement 3d
> rigid bodies, and then 3d editor. But I think that first of all we
> should make usable 2d version.
If you define an editor as "particle distribution will be generated at random,
but the use can can define parameters (# of particles, min/min density, ...)"
then an editor should be fairly easy.
From that on, implement the "real editor" step by step.
